10 U.S.C. § 6160Information relating to certain defense nuclear nonproliferation programs

(a)Technologies and Capabilities.—

The Administrator shall document, for efforts that are not focused on basic research, the technologies and capabilities of the defense nuclear nonproliferation research and development program that—

(1)

are transitioned to end users for further development or deployment; and

(2)

are deployed.

(b)Assessments of Status.—
(1)

In assessing projects under the defense nuclear nonproliferation research and development program or the defense nuclear nonproliferation and arms control program, the Administrator shall compare the status of each such project, including with respect to the final results of such project, to the baseline targets and goals established in the initial project plan of such project.

(2)

The Administrator may carry out paragraph (1) using a common template or such other means as the Administrator determines appropriate.

Source credit: (Added and amended Pub. L. 119–60, div. C, title XXXI, § 3111(a), (d)(2)(B), Dec. 18, 2025, 139 Stat. 1385, 1462.)
